**About this work area**As Product Quality & Recovery Co-worker your respon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:
- Engaging and assist customers in understanding their needs and providing your knowledge on IKEA products and services to support their purchasing decisions.
- Present IKEA products in As-Is using a strong commercial expression, selling these products with pride and setting relevant prices that are attractive to customers yet still generate the best results for the store.
- Take necessary action on products to give them a second chance, such as repackaging them back into a saleable condition.
- Assembling our products according to proper building and enclosed instructions to ensure complete functionality.
- Support the quality work in the store to constantly improve customers' quality perception of IKEA products.
- Always consider the sustainability impact when deciding when and how to recover products.
- Building strong relationships with your team and other departments to promote a collaborative and inclusive work environment that cultivates a strong understanding of product recovery, quality and compliance processes.
- Maintaining a safe and secure environment within the IKEA store, always ensuring the well-being of both customers and co-workers.
As Product Quality & Recovery Co-worker you are, or you have
- A 'Togetherness' mindset where you'll work closely with your team and other departments yet also be able to work independently.
- A passion for building furniture, our products, and our sustainability initiatives.
- Experience with regular use of computers and IT systems.
- Strong customer focus, ensuring we keep the customer in mind no matter what we do.
- Ability to prioritise tasks in a fast-paced environment and ability and be able to think outside of the box.
- A safety mindset and being comfortable with physical work and manual handling including repetitive heavy lifting.
- Motivated, results-driven mindset that does not shy away from challenges.
- Comfortable with the physicality associated with this role, similar to a warehouse co-worker.
